IGNOU Launches PG Diploma In Agricultural Cost Management, MA In Bhagavad Gita And Other Courses

IGNOU has launched Master’s Programme in several fields, including PG Diploma in Agriculture Cost Management, which intends to promote sustainable agricultural practices by teaching cost management, enhancing yields, and improving farmer livelihoods. Not only this, the Open University has offered other specialised courses, including a postgraduate diploma in Disaster Management, a Master’s in Bhagavad Gita studies and a Bachelor of Arts in Home Science. These programmes will be conducted under the School of Humanities at IGNOU.

PG Diploma in Agricultural Cost Management

The PG Diploma in Agricultural Cost Management will be conducted by IGNOU’s School of Agriculture in collaboration with the Institute of Cost Accountants of India (ICMAI). The key objective of this course is to encourage sustainable agricultural practices by teaching cost management, improving yields, and enhancing farmers’ livelihoods. Additionally, the course will support agribusiness training, preparing students to navigate the competitive, high-tech, and fluctuating agriculture market, encouraging entrepreneurship among farmers, traders, and other stakeholders

Other courses in Disaster Management and Home Science

The PG diploma in Disaster Management will provide training to students so that they can respond effectively to numerous disasters like floods, earthquakes, tsunamis, and landslides. Not only this, the course also includes disaster prevention, mitigation, preparedness, response, recovery, and rehabilitation. Additionally, the new Bachelor of Arts in Home Science programme offer a comprehensive education and awareness in areas like Human Development, Family Studies, Nutrition, Resource Management, Fabric and Apparel Sciences, and Extension Education. It is designed to meet the rising demand for specialisation in these areas and to improve employability through practical and theoretical learning. Notably, all the programmes are aligned with the framework of the University Grants Commission and the National Education Policy (NEP) 2020, providing a blend of theory and skill-based learning.
